Fellows of the Royal Society of Chemistry will be working in a senior position and have been doing their role for 5 or more years. The Fellow will have demonstrated they hold senior responsibilities, have strategic influence within the workplace and/or sector or have made outstanding contributions to the chemical sciences and/or to the advancement of the profession.

The award of Chartered Science Teacher (CSciTeach) status is a peer-reviewed process and is the demonstration of high-quality science teaching. It lies at the heart of inspiring and nurturing the next generation of chemical scientists. CSciTeach recognises those individuals who demonstrate excellence in science teaching and learning.

CSciTeach awardees have shown they have developed skills in 3 competency areas:
• Professional knowledge and understanding
• Professional practice
• Professional attributes

The Royal Society of Chemistry is the UK's professional body for chemical scientists, maintains standards of competence and professional practice and provides support and representation for its members bringing together chemical scientists from all over the world.
